The Heard County Braves will face off against the Pepperell Dragons at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Heard County has 16 straight victories, Pepperell has three straight losses), but none of that matters once you're on the court.
Heard County is returning to their home court after beating Temple on theirs, despite the fact Temple has dominated at home this season. Heard County enjoyed a cozy 51-37 win over Temple on Friday. Given the Braves' advantage in MaxPreps' Georgia basketball rankings (they are ranked 44th, while the Tigers are ranked 168th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Meanwhile, Pepperell ended up a good deal behind Temple on Monday and lost 66-49.
Heard County's victory was their seventh stra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 19-2. They've dominated over that stretch too, winning by an average of 19.9 points. As for Pepperell, their defeat dropped their record down to 6-17.
Everything went Heard County's way against Pepperell in their previous matchup back in January, as Heard County made off with a 64-41 win. Does Heard County have another victory up their sleeve, or will Pepperell tur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
